Having now booted both the old and new kernels, I don't get the SATA- related errors in the syslog at all. Here I'm including the output of dmesg in the new kernel from today's experiments. I've also run short smartctl tests in the old and new kernel environments without provoking read errors in the tests, although the SMART attribute "Raw_Read_Error_Rate" has risen from 774 to 779.
